#2c54fc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2c54fc is composed of 17.3% red, 32.9% green and 98.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.5% cyan, 66.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 228.5 degrees, a saturation of 97.2% and a lightness of 58%. #2c54fc color hex could be obtained by blending #58a8ff with #0000f9.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#2c54fc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2c54fc has RGB values of R:44, G:84, B:252 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0.67,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 2905340.
| Hex triplet | 2c54fc | #2c54fc |
|---|---|---|
| RGB Decimal | 44, 84, 252 | rgb(44,84,252) |
| RGB Percent | 17.3, 32.9, 98.8 | rgb(17.3%,32.9%,98.8%) |
| CMYK | 83, 67, 0, 1 | |
| HSL | 228.5°, 97.2, 58 | hsl(228.5,97.2%,58%) |
| HSV (or HSB) | 228.5°, 82.5, 98.8 | |
| Web Safe | 3366ff | #3366ff |
| CIE-LAB | 44.093, 46.928, -86.576 |
|---|---|
| XYZ | 21.776, 13.903, 93.626 |
| xyY | 0.168, 0.108, 13.903 |
| CIE-LCH | 44.093, 98.476, 298.46 |
| CIE-LUV | 44.093, -15.733, -128.151 |
| Hunter-Lab | 37.286, 38.997, -122.776 |
| Binary | 00101100, 01010100, 11111100 |
